This video is part of Project South of The Sahara. It's a YouTube history collaboration where channels come together to celebrate the less told tales of African history, specifically those that take place south of the Sahara desert. So much of African historical focus is on North Africa, and while it's certainly important, the rest is a bit overshadowed. In this video we will focus on the Kingdom of Kongo and it's mark on African history.
